i have 35 psi recommended max on my front and have them at 38-40 with no problem, my rears are 44 max and i keep them at that. i need to get off my @$$ and get all four the same kind, anyway i keep mine as full as possible for the following reasons:

a: here in s.c., it is hot outside, i don't want my tires messing up by getting any hotter than necessary. (which happens when underinflated)

b: fuel economy. i live 12 miles from work, i need all the help on this i can get, especially with my heavy foot.

c: getting a good launch at the light is not as important to me as being able to weave in and out of traffic and corner hard without driving on my sidewalls.

i guess it depends on where you live and how you drive, if you live in the country or around rough roads, or if you drag race alot, you will probably want a little less pressure.  i live in the city and do most of my driving at 45+ on interstates and bypasses, and no-one will ever race with me, oh well.
